Output 7eed11573aae24471a506b75fc27ba65995a4b8a9d8df16b97668c3e94bb2dcc:5

value
289581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03bfdc8f79119a582612bf2ee60db996fd642905 OP_EQUAL
address
322qntq7yKkYpXQjSy1buH5fG3bP5zpSAb
transaction
7eed11573aae24471a506b75fc27ba65995a4b8a9d8df16b97668c3e94bb2dcc
confirmations
158000
spent
true